Output c03bb129c0b0ad6dca8124368f030d4592fcf0ce5bfaf51224ab92de3a0ea344:1

value
2623669
script pubkey
OP_0 OP_PUSHBYTES_20 ba65f2f44bddd85749b635ed769178de889d9fb3
address
bc1qhfjl9aztmhv9wjdkxhkhdytcm6yfm8anp86cv6
transaction
c03bb129c0b0ad6dca8124368f030d4592fcf0ce5bfaf51224ab92de3a0ea344
confirmations
182524
spent
true